Inside the magnificent Museo de Bellas Artes in Bilbao, I captured a moment that feels alive with history and emotion. The photograph centers on a towering wall brimming with portrait paintings, each from a different era, their diverse styles converging into a stunning mosaic of artistic opulence. The richness of the visual tapestry—a mixture of gilded frames, expressive faces, and varied palettes—evokes a sense of timeless grandeur. This interplay between the art pieces and the space itself creates a dynamic dialogue, where past and present viewers connect through the sheer weight of visual storytelling. It’s a celebration of artistic legacy and human connection in one striking frame.

Captured inside the Museum of Contemporary Art of the University of São Paulo, this photograph highlights a photobook by Cassio Vasconcellos, an acclaimed photographer from São Paulo. The image reflects the intersection of Brazilian modernity and visual narrative, encapsulating Vasconcellos' profound exploration of landscapes and urbanity.
